Is this normal/reasonable?

No, getting that few cards sounds like a massive case of bad luck!

Each enemy has their own card drop chance, roughly based on how keyboard smashingly annoying they are to kill! So, for example, Rabbys have a 1/300 card drop rate, while bees have 1/100 card drop rate. Elites have a much higher card drop rate. To be precise, it's 90 % higher!

EDIT: Ooops, 90 % was a typo! Elites are 10 times as likely to drop cards as regular enemies!
